Ask HN: Does anyone here use Discord as their work chat tool?

2•Poomba•1h ago
Does anyone here use Discord for their workplace comms?

We are outgrowing Zulip as our team chat tool and are anti-Microsoft, so Teams is definitely out. Slack is the “default” choice but their pricing leaves a lot to be desired, especially if you want SSO, longer history of saved conversations, etc

Which leaves me to Discord. I know it seems like an unconventional choice but does anyone here use it in their workplace? And how do you find it?

Hello Poomba, our development team actually made this switch some time ago, and to be honest, we now prefer it to Slack. The pricing problem is entirely resolved by the free unlimited message history, and it's much easier to start a persistent voice channel than to set up Slack Huddles.

You will undoubtedly miss the strict threading because you are coming from Zulip. My main recommendation is to make the most of Discord's "Forum" channels. They are ideal for organizing feature discussions and bug reports without packing the main chat.

The only significant drawback we discovered is that Discord doesn't come with organized work tools because it was designed for communities.
